Question JVC AV28WFT Default Service menu settings or Factory Reset ?

Does anyone know the stantdard settings for the service menu. With particular the 'DEF' section of the service menu. Or is there a way to perform a factory reset ?

(For the model AV28WFT1EK)

Dear all,

Below is a list of settings for picture alignment for the JVC AV28WFT for those (like myself) who forgot to write the settings down before changing the setting to comensate the RGB picture shift.
For use under DEF Menu (to access service menu press i and mute together).

I have taken the settings from three different sets (in various stores so I know the service setting haven't been messed with). To obtain default settings simply use an average of the values below (or try each set), most of settings are similar to with +/- 1 across the three different tv sets.



No. in Menu refers to the items under the DEF service menu

Mode No.Menu Dixon Currys Comet
Panaramic
1 -8 -2 -11
2 8 9 10
3 -8 -8 -8
4 -4 -5 -5
5 11 10 9
6 15 17 16
7 -4 -4 -4

Full
1 0 0 0
2 -10 -7 -8
3 0 0 0
4 0 0 0
5 -6 -5 -5
6 1 1 0
7 0 -1 0

16:09
1 0 -1 -1
2 34 34 34
3 0 0 0
4 -1 -1 -1
5 -5 -3 -3
6 -2 -1 -4
7 -2 -6 -2

Regular
1 0 0 -1
2 -7 -7 -7
3 0 0 0
4 -2 -2 -1
5 -16 -17 -17
6 0 0 -1
7 1 0 0

14:09
1 0 0 0
2 13 16 13
3 0 0 0
4 -3 -1 -3
5 -6 -7 -6
6 0 1 0
7 0 -2 0

Sorry about the formating but to clarify (the first number on the left under each zoom mode indicates the menu item under the DEF menu)
The numbers to the right of that indicate the settings found on the TV in Dixons, comet, currys (2nd,3rd,and 4th across respectively). i.e 1=V-shift (ithink) and the settings for the Full Zoom where 0, 0, and 0

For the other Zoom modes you'll have to look for yourselves I didn't have time to get them all only the main ones. If you do manage to get the setting for the other Zoom modes please post them on this thread.
